split,slice,splice,replace的用法

Posted 老婆大人

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了split,slice,splice,replace的用法相关的知识,希望对你有一定的参考价值。

split()方法用于把一个字符串分割成字符串数组

str.split("字符串/正则表达式从该参数制定额地方分割str",可选,可指定返回数组的最大长度,如果没设置参数,整个字符长都被分割,不考虑长度)

slice();方法可从已有的数组中返回选定的元素

slice()方法可提取字符串的某个部分,并以新的字符串返回被提取的部分

slice()方法不会改变原数组

slice(start,end)憨头不含尾

splice()方法时从数组中添加或者删除元素,然后返回被删除后的数组

splice(位置,个数);

位置:整数 如果使用如数可从数组尾处规定位置

个数:要删除的个数,如果为0,就是一个都没删除

var arr=[a,2,4,6];

console.log(arr.splice(2,1));--》arr[a,2,6]

replace()方法用于在字符串中用一些字符串代替另一些字符串,常与正则表达式连用

var str=‘abc12345cde‘;

console.log(str.replace(/(\d)/g,‘[$1]‘));-->abc1234[5]cde

 

以上是关于split,slice,splice,replace的用法的主要内容,如果未能解决你的问题,请参考以下文章

区分数组的splice,split,slice方法

split slice splice的简单区别

slice,splice,split方法

区分slice,splice,split

区分slice,splice和split方法

区分slice,splice和split方法